CompleteKaryTree[n,k]
returns a complete k-ary tree on n vertices.

Details and Options
- CompleteKaryTree functionality is now available in the built-in Wolfram Language function KaryTree.
- To use CompleteKaryTree, you first need to load the Combinatorica Package using Needs["Combinatorica`"].
